

Virginia Murray Davidson, age 71 of Richmond, Va., passed away unexpectedly after a brief battle with cancer. She was born in Richmond, Va., on September 20, 1944 to William W. And Virginia Avery Murray. She graduated in 1962 from Thomas Jefferson High School and her following business career was varied and ended at Lakewood Manor. In addition to her parents, she was predeceased by a brother, William Wesley Murray Jr., and brother in law, William C. Snow Jr. She is survived by a most loving husband of 44 years, Earl A. Davidson. She is also survived by her three sons, William Clinton Snow III, Dr. Wesley Neilson Snow (Molly), and Todd Winn Davidson (Michelle). Additionally she is also survived by her grandchildren, Heath Davidson, Wyatt Davidson, Ethan Snow, Jack Snow and Reagan Snow. She is also survived by her sister, Diane M. Snow who loved and will miss her forever; two nephews, Scott Maxey and Ross Snow; two great nephews, Parker A. Snow and Declan M. Snow. She is also survived by sister in law, Julia Davidson and a large extended family. Anyone who was privileged to know "Ginny" knew she never left home without being perfectly "coiffed" and beautiful, and she was beautiful inside and out. A celebration of her life will be held at 1:30pm, on Wednesday, November 25, 2015, at the Parham Chapel of Woody Funeral Home, 1771 N Parham Rd. Interment Greenwood Memorial Gardens. Even though Ginny loved flowers she would have wanted donations to go to The Richmond Christmas Mother to feed the hungry and less fortunate.
